WTI Oil Jumps Past $84 as US Resumes Strikes in Iran

West Texas Intermediate crude surged above $84 per barrel on Thursday, gaining around 7% over two days, after the US resumed military strikes against Iran.

USOIL

Oil prices rallied sharply, with the US benchmark West Texas Intermediate (WTI) breaking through $84 a barrel. The advance represents a roughly 7% gain from the prior low of $77.16, recorded earlier in the week.

The move followed reports that the United States had renewed military strikes on targets inside Iran, heightening geopolitical risk and supply concerns. The escalation gave a strong bid to crude, pushing prices to levels not seen in recent sessions.
